The Cabinet Committee on Government Purchase (CCGP) has approved a total purchase proposal of Tk 948,11,52,178 for the printing, binding, and distribution of free textbooks across primary, Ebtedayee, secondary, Dakhil, and technical education levels for the upcoming 2027 academic year.
The approval was granted on Thursday (August 6) during a meeting held at the Secretariat, chaired by Finance Minister Amir Khosru Mahmud Chowdhury.
According to meeting sources, 63 printing firms secured contracts worth Tk 404,02,02,297.39 to print 7,35,80,235 copies of primary-level (Classes 1–5) textbooks across 106 out of 110 tender lots. Additionally, 35 printing firms were awarded contracts totaling Tk 153,91,95,590 to print 3,18,10,732 copies for Ebtedayee level students (Classes 1–5).
For the secondary level (Bangla and English versions), Dakhil, and technical education streams, the committee approved printing, binding, and delivery contracts worth Tk 183,58,45,256 for Class 6 (4,11,61,053 copies across 70 tenders awarded to 63 firms) and Tk 206,59,08,939 for Class 7 (3,84,44,984 copies across 69 tenders awarded to 59 firms).
